// Copyright 2013-2015 Apcera Inc. All rights reserved.
package server
import (
"crypto/tls"
"net/url"
"reflect"
"testing"
"time"
)
func TestDefaultOptions(t *testing.T) {
golden := &Options{
Host: DEFAULT_HOST,
Port: DEFAULT_PORT,
MaxConn: DEFAULT_MAX_CONNECTIONS,
PingInterval: DEFAULT_PING_INTERVAL,
MaxPingsOut: DEFAULT_PING_MAX_OUT,
TLSTimeout: float64(TLS_TIMEOUT) / float64(time.Second),
AuthTimeout: float64(AUTH_TIMEOUT) / float64(time.Second),
MaxControlLine: MAX_CONTROL_LINE_SIZE,
MaxPayload: MAX_PAYLOAD_SIZE,
MaxPending: MAX_PENDING_SIZE,
ClusterAuthTimeout: float64(AUTH_TIMEOUT) / float64(time.Second),
ClusterTLSTimeout: float64(TLS_TIMEOUT) / float64(time.Second),
BufSize: DEFAULT_BUF_SIZE,
}
opts := &Options{}
processOptions(opts)
if !reflect.DeepEqual(golden, opts) {
t.Fatalf("Default Options are incorrect.\nexpected: %+v\ngot: %+v",
golden, opts)
}
}
func TestOptions_RandomPort(t *testing.T) {
opts := &Options{Port: RANDOM_PORT}
processOptions(opts)
if opts.Port != 0 {
t.Fatalf("Process of options should have resolved random port to "+
"zero.\nexpected: %d\ngot: %d\n", 0, opts.Port)
}
}
func TestConfigFile(t *testing.T) {
golden := &Options{
Host: "localhost",
Port: 4242,
Username: "derek",
Password: "bella",
AuthTimeout: 1.0,
Debug: false,
Trace: true,
Logtime: false,
HTTPPort: 8222,
LogFile: "/tmp/gnatsd.log",
PidFile: "/tmp/gnatsd.pid",
ProfPort: 6543,
Syslog: true,
RemoteSyslog: "udp://foo.com:33",
MaxControlLine: 2048,
MaxPayload: 65536,
MaxConn: 100,
MaxPending: 10000000,
}
opts, err := ProcessConfigFile("./configs/test.conf")
if err != nil {
t.Fatalf("Received an error reading config file: %v\n", err)
}
if !reflect.DeepEqual(golden, opts) {
t.Fatalf("Options are incorrect.\nexpected: %+v\ngot: %+v",
golden, opts)
}
}
func TestTLSConfigFile(t *testing.T) {
golden := &Options{
Host: "localhost",
Port: 4443,
Username: "derek",
Password: "buckley",
AuthTimeout: 1.0,
TLSTimeout: 2.0,
}
opts, err := ProcessConfigFile("./configs/tls.conf")
if err != nil {
t.Fatalf("Received an error reading config file: %v\n", err)
}
tlsConfig := opts.TLSConfig
if tlsConfig == nil {
t.Fatal("Expected opts.TLSConfig to be non-nil")
}
opts.TLSConfig = nil
if !reflect.DeepEqual(golden, opts) {
t.Fatalf("Options are incorrect.\nexpected: %+v\ngot: %+v",
golden, opts)
}
// Now check TLSConfig a bit more closely
// CipherSuites
ciphers := defaultCipherSuites()
if !reflect.DeepEqual(tlsConfig.CipherSuites, ciphers) {
t.Fatalf("Got incorrect cipher suite list: [%+v]", tlsConfig.CipherSuites)
}
if tlsConfig.MinVersion != tls.VersionTLS12 {
t.Fatalf("Expected MinVersion of 1.2 [%v], got [%v]", tls.VersionTLS12, tlsConfig.MinVersion)
}
if !tlsConfig.PreferServerCipherSuites {
t.Fatal("Expected PreferServerCipherSuites to be true")
}
// Verify hostname is correct in certificate
if len(tlsConfig.Certificates) != 1 {
t.Fatal("Expected 1 certificate")
}
cert := tlsConfig.Certificates[0].Leaf
if err := cert.VerifyHostname("localhost"); err != nil {
t.Fatalf("Could not verify hostname in certificate: %v\n", err)
}
// Now test adding cipher suites.
opts, err = ProcessConfigFile("./configs/tls_ciphers.conf")
if err != nil {
t.Fatalf("Received an error reading config file: %v\n", err)
}
tlsConfig = opts.TLSConfig
if tlsConfig == nil {
t.Fatal("Expected opts.TLSConfig to be non-nil")
}
// CipherSuites listed in the config - test all of them.
ciphers = []uint16{
tls.TLS_RSA_WITH_RC4_128_SHA,
tls.TLS_RSA_WITH_3DES_EDE_CBC_SHA,
tls.TLS_RSA_WITH_AES_128_CBC_SHA,
tls.TLS_RSA_WITH_AES_256_CBC_SHA,
tls.TLS_ECDHE_ECDSA_WITH_RC4_128_SHA,
tls.TLS_ECDHE_ECDSA_WITH_AES_128_CBC_SHA,
tls.TLS_ECDHE_ECDSA_WITH_AES_256_CBC_SHA,
tls.TLS_ECDHE_RSA_WITH_RC4_128_SHA,
tls.TLS_ECDHE_RSA_WITH_3DES_EDE_CBC_SHA,
tls.TLS_ECDHE_RSA_WITH_AES_128_CBC_SHA,
tls.TLS_ECDHE_RSA_WITH_AES_256_CBC_SHA,
tls.TLS_ECDHE_RSA_WITH_AES_128_GCM_SHA256,
tls.TLS_ECDHE_ECDSA_WITH_AES_128_GCM_SHA256,
}
if !reflect.DeepEqual(tlsConfig.CipherSuites, ciphers) {
t.Fatalf("Got incorrect cipher suite list: [%+v]", tlsConfig.CipherSuites)
}
// Test an unrecognized/bad cipher
opts, err = ProcessConfigFile("./configs/tls_bad_cipher.conf")
if err == nil {
t.Fatalf("Did not receive an error from a unrecognized cipher.")
}
// Test an empty cipher entry in a config file.
opts, err = ProcessConfigFile("./configs/tls_empty_cipher.conf")
if err == nil {
t.Fatalf("Did not receive an error from empty cipher_suites.")
}
}
func TestMergeOverrides(t *testing.T) {
golden := &Options{
Host: "localhost",
Port: 2222,
Username: "derek",
Password: "spooky",
AuthTimeout: 1.0,
Debug: true,
Trace: true,
Logtime: false,
HTTPPort: DEFAULT_HTTP_PORT,
LogFile: "/tmp/gnatsd.log",
PidFile: "/tmp/gnatsd.pid",
ProfPort: 6789,
Syslog: true,
RemoteSyslog: "udp://foo.com:33",
MaxControlLine: 2048,
MaxPayload: 65536,
MaxConn: 100,
MaxPending: 10000000,
}
fopts, err := ProcessConfigFile("./configs/test.conf")
if err != nil {
t.Fatalf("Received an error reading config file: %v\n", err)
}
// Overrides via flags
opts := &Options{
Port: 2222,
Password: "spooky",
Debug: true,
HTTPPort: DEFAULT_HTTP_PORT,
ProfPort: 6789,
}
merged := MergeOptions(fopts, opts)
if !reflect.DeepEqual(golden, merged) {
t.Fatalf("Options are incorrect.\nexpected: %+v\ngot: %+v",
golden, merged)
}
}
func TestRemoveSelfReference(t *testing.T) {
url1, _ := url.Parse("nats-route://user:password@10.4.5.6:4223")
url2, _ := url.Parse("nats-route://user:password@localhost:4223")
url3, _ := url.Parse("nats-route://user:password@127.0.0.1:4223")
routes := []*url.URL{url1, url2, url3}
newroutes, err := RemoveSelfReference(4223, routes)
if err != nil {
t.Fatalf("Error during RemoveSelfReference: %v", err)
}
if len(newroutes) != 1 {
t.Fatalf("Wrong number of routes: %d", len(newroutes))
}
if newroutes[0] != routes[0] {
t.Fatalf("Self reference IP address %s in Routes", routes[0])
}
}
func TestAllowRouteWithDifferentPort(t *testing.T) {
url1, _ := url.Parse("nats-route://user:password@127.0.0.1:4224")
routes := []*url.URL{url1}
newroutes, err := RemoveSelfReference(4223, routes)
if err != nil {
t.Fatalf("Error during RemoveSelfReference: %v", err)
}
if len(newroutes) != 1 {
t.Fatalf("Wrong number of routes: %d", len(newroutes))
}
}
func TestRouteFlagOverride(t *testing.T) {
routeFlag := "nats-route://ruser:top_secret@127.0.0.1:8246"
rurl, _ := url.Parse(routeFlag)
golden := &Options{
Host: "127.0.0.1",
Port: 7222,
ClusterHost: "127.0.0.1",
ClusterPort: 7244,
ClusterUsername: "ruser",
ClusterPassword: "top_secret",
ClusterAuthTimeout: 0.5,
Routes: []*url.URL{rurl},
RoutesStr: routeFlag,
}
fopts, err := ProcessConfigFile("./configs/srv_a.conf")
if err != nil {
t.Fatalf("Received an error reading config file: %v\n", err)
}
// Overrides via flags
opts := &Options{
RoutesStr: routeFlag,
}
merged := MergeOptions(fopts, opts)
if !reflect.DeepEqual(golden, merged) {
t.Fatalf("Options are incorrect.\nexpected: %+v\ngot: %+v",
golden, merged)
}
}
func TestRouteFlagOverrideWithMultiple(t *testing.T) {
routeFlag := "nats-route://ruser:top_secret@127.0.0.1:8246, nats-route://ruser:top_secret@127.0.0.1:8266"
rurls := RoutesFromStr(routeFlag)
golden := &Options{
Host: "127.0.0.1",
Port: 7222,
ClusterHost: "127.0.0.1",
ClusterPort: 7244,
ClusterUsername: "ruser",
ClusterPassword: "top_secret",
ClusterAuthTimeout: 0.5,
Routes: rurls,
RoutesStr: routeFlag,
}
fopts, err := ProcessConfigFile("./configs/srv_a.conf")
if err != nil {
t.Fatalf("Received an error reading config file: %v\n", err)
}
// Overrides via flags
opts := &Options{
RoutesStr: routeFlag,
}
merged := MergeOptions(fopts, opts)
if !reflect.DeepEqual(golden, merged) {
t.Fatalf("Options are incorrect.\nexpected: %+v\ngot: %+v",
golden, merged)
}
}
